Notes and quotes from Wednesday’s practice

By Steve Corkran
Wednesday, August 18th, 2010 at 9:31 pm in Oakland Raiders.

Kyle Boller’s magical mystery tour through Raiders training camp just keeps getting better and better.

He arrived at training camp as the No. 4 quarterback, well behind backup candidates Bruce Gradkowski and Charlie Frye, who combined for seven starts last season, and just hopeful of getting some positive plays on film.

Now, he is making steady progress toward earning a spot on Oakland’s 53-man roster through his impressive showing in practice and the Raiders first exhibition game, as well injuries to Gradkowski and Frye.

“He’s doing well,” Raiders coach Tom Cable said after Wednesday’s practice. “The game against Dallas speaks for itself, and he’ll get another opportunity this weekend to see if he can consistently do that.”

This weekend, as in Saturday night against the Chicago Bears in the second of four exhibition games.

Jason Campbell will start the game and give way to Boller at some point in the first half.

With Frye and Gradkowski not expected to play, Boller can count on extensive playing time once again. He made the most of it against the Cowboys.

“I’ve been in this business long enough to know that you’re a play away from being in there, so I’ve always taken the approach to prepare like a starter,” Boller said. “I watch the same amount of tape. You have to be ready when you’re opportunity comes.

“It seems as the years go on, more and more guys get hurt, unfortunately. That’s why you have to take advantage when opportunities present themselves.”

Boller also benefits from the year he spent with Raiders offensive coordinator Hue Jackson when they were with the Baltimore Ravens.

“It does help because there is a confidence for Kyle, and he understands because he’s been coached by that guy,” Cable said. “He understands what he’s looking for, what he’s asking for. That helps him being able to step in and have some confidence right from the beginning.”

 

– Cable said fourth-string quarterback Colt Brennan “probably” will play against the Bears. Brennan didn’t get an opportunity to play against the Cowboys in Oakland’s first exhibition game.

 

– Cable heaped high praise upon strong-side (“Sam) linebacker Kamerion Wimbley. In the process, he disparaged the likes of Ricky Brown and Sam Williams.

“The thing I am most excited about is Dallas ran three power plays in there and, for the first time since I have been around here, our ‘Sam’ backer stood up the fullback all three times. That’s what he brings. He understands what you’re asking him to do; plays it the way you’re asking.”

The Raiders traded for Wimbley during the offseason and gave up almost nothing to the Cleveland Browns for a first-round draft pick five years ago.

 

– Frye on Wednesday underwent a surgical procedure to repair damage to his right (throwing) wrist. Cable said he won’t know how long Frye is out for until he rejoins the team in the next few days.

 

– Running back Darren McFadden (hamstring) did not practice Wednesday and won’t play against the Chicago Bears on Saturday night, Cable said.

On the bright side, McFadden is making great progress toward a return to the practice field for the first time since Aug. 7.

“He is much, much improved,” Cable said, “and he is pretty close to being ready to go but, again, I am probably going to lean toward being more protective now.”

 

– Wide receiver Chaz Schilens (foot), right offensive tackle Langston Walker (rest) and cornerback Chris Johnson (hamstring) also missed practice.

Receiver Darrius Heyward-Bey dressed for practice and participated in some drills, though not at full capacity. He didn’t run any routes and spent most of his time watching his teammates from a distance.

Cable dismissed the suggestion that Heyward-Bey is nursing a sore hamstring. However, Heyward-Bey was sporting a sizable wrap that extended from below his left knee and somewhere up around the thigh region.

It seemed rather apparent in practice Monday that Heyward-Bey tweaked his hamstring. Yet, Cable says Heyward-Bey’s lack of activity the past two days owes more to “fatigue.”

 

– Jackson was at his animated best during several drills Wednesday. At one point, he ordered backup offensive lineman Khalif Barnes off the field for a false-start penalty.

“Get me another left tackle,” Jackson said. “We ain’t doing that no more. We can’t be jumping offside. You do, you’re out of there.”

 

– Based upon absolutely nothing, other than 15 years covering the Raiders and having a feel for how managing general partner Al Davis operates: Look for the Raiders to sign veteran wide receiver Torry Holt now that he is gone from the New England Patriots.

The Raiders need a veteran presence, several of their receivers have been in and out of the lineup because of nagging injuries and a team never can have enough proven playmakers.

Remember, Davis has a long history of signing receivers with comparable resumes to that of Holt – James Lofton, Andre Rison, Jerry Rice and Javon Walker come to mind.

 

– Speaking of Davis, he was at practice Wednesday for the sixth time since camp opened July 29. Hue Jackson broke from practice for about a 10-minute one-on-one with Davis.

It was unclear who was doing most of the talking. Davis spoke from a golf cart, while Jackson took a knee on the grass between the two fields.

 

– Rookie safety Stevie Brown intercepted yet another pass in what has become an all too common occurrence at camp.

Brown caught the carom off the hands of fullback Alex Daniels’ hands and the hands of at least two other players. Brown also intercepted a pass on the final play of the Cowboys game.

 

– Rookie cornerback Jeremy Ware worked with the first-team in the nickel package as part of Cable’s plan to get a look at the younger players against seasoned players.

 

– Linebacker Sam Williams (concussion) said he expects to be back at practice within the next few days.

“I’m still a little cloudy, but I’m getting there,” Williams said in reference to his head. He added that he hasn’t passed the required tests necessary for his return.

 

– Backup tight end Brandon Myers was unable to finish practice because of a pass that hit off the end of one of his fingers. Cable said Myers was sent for an X-ray. No word on the findings just yet.

 

– Observations from one-on-one drills between offensive and defensive linemen: rookie Jared Veldheer held off defensive end Matt Shaughnessy on back-to-back snaps.

Defensive end Trevor Scott abused right offensive tackle Erik Pears on back-to-back plays, one to the outside, one on the inside.

Defensive tackle William Joseph got the better of rookie guard Bruce Campbell on one play, but he got neutralized the second go round.

Left guard Robert Gallery stonewalled defensive tackle Richard Seymour on back-to-back plays.

Or, as Cable is fond of saying, that’s just another example of “iron sharpens iron.”

 

– Tight end Zach Miller was a one-man wrecking crew during passing drills, as usual.

He caught passes for touchdowns three times in a short span, one for 30 yards from Campbell, two others from Boller.

Safety Jerome Boyd, safety Stevie Brown and linebacker David Nixon were victimized, in order.

You get the sense that the only things that can prevent Miller from improving upon last season’s impressive stats are injuries and a steady diet of double teams (bracket coverage).

    “Socially Allen traveled in lofty circles. He was a regular guest at Simpson’s Brentwood estate with Al Cowlings and other sports luminaries such as Kareem Abdul-Jabbar, Ahmad Rashad, and Lynn Swann. But his success was leading him to trouble as he gained more attention from the media and the Raiders team and owner got less. Raiders maverick owner Al Davis was becoming increasingly aware that one of his players was being singled out above the team. Allen continued his individual brilliance the following year in 1984, leading the league in touchdowns with 18 and gaining 1,168 yards, but the Raiders faltered. By the end of the season Davis was openly calling Allen a selfish player to his coaching staff.

    Allen went into the 1985 season at the top of his game and became the centerpiece of the Raiders offense. He justified the organization’s confidence with a breakout season. He gained 1,759 yards on the ground and set a single-season NFL record with 2,314 total yards. He was named the Player of the Year and voted to his third Pro Bowl, but the 12-4 Raiders again lost in the first round of the playoffs. Davis was soon complaining about the team being too ” one dimensional.”

    Allen hoped to follow up the 1985 season with another strong campaign, but he injured his ankle in the third game. Despite the lack of any fracture, the pain did not go away throughout the season. Allen tried to play through the pain and even took a shot of painkillers before one game to be able to play. But he could not play the same. In a pivotal game with the Philadelphia Eagles, Allen fumbled the ball as the Raiders were in the midst of a game- winning drive, and the team lost the game. The Raiders lost the next four contests to finish the season out of the playoffs. Many Raiders observers felt that Allen’s career with the organization went downhill after that one game against the Eagles.

    The 1987 season opened again with a players’ strike. Davis viewed the action as a personal betrayal rather than a work stoppage. Allen was one of the players who stayed out of camp over the course of the entire strike. He had another surprise waiting for him when he returned to the Raiders. Davis signed baseball player and college football star Bo Jackson to play for the team in the second half of the season. Allen regarded this move as an attempt to replace him, but he kept his feelings to himself. Midway through a frustrating season, he even volunteered to play fullback while Jackson played tailback. This arrangement improved the tense situation, but the Raiders were a team in decline. Longtime Raiders head coach Tom Flores even retired after the disappointing 1987 season.

    The new man to lead the Raiders was former Broncos assistant Mike Shanahan. Shanahan tried to change the Raiders’ long-ball system, but was often overruled by Davis. Allen had another mediocre campaign in 1988 splitting time with Jackson. He gained 831 yards on the ground and caught only 34 passes. The only bright side of the 1988 season for Allen came outside of the professional arena. He met Kathryn Eickstaedt, a model from Wisconsin, who would become his wife.

    Allen’s contract was up after the season and his agent was made to wait until the beginning of the next regular season for a new contract offer. Allen returned to a team in turmoil. Shanahan was fired after four games. The next coach was former Raiders player and assistant coach Art Shell, the first black head coach in the NFL. Allen’s excitement at playing for the new coach was tempered after he injured his knee in the first game of Shell’s tenure. He spent eight weeks on the inactive list and did not get significant playing time for the rest of the season. The 1990 season began as the previous one did–with Allen holding out, or, depending on one’s point of view, being held out. When he finally returned to camp, he was listed as the fourth running back. And matters did not improve for the former star. Allen claimed that all the coaches had been instructed by Davis not to play him and even Raider quarterback Jay Schroeder had been told not to throw the ball his way. Though the Raiders won the AFL West that year, Allen was used only in short yardage situations when the team desperately needed yards. The 1991 season started off badly as he tore a ligament in his knee in the first game. Allen missed eight games, and the Raiders lost to Kansas City in the first round of the playoffs.

    In 1992 the five-time Pro Bowl player was again listed fourth on the depth chart. Allen was told before games that he would not be playing and was used only for third-down plays. He would sit on the end of the bench separate from the rest of the team. After walking out of practice one day, Allen decided he had had enough. He called Shell and demanded to be traded, but Shell told him Davis would not trade him. After confronting Davis, Allen was told that no other team would be interested in him. Allen was stuck being the best football player on a team that would not play him. Allen felt he had no choice but to file a free agency lawsuit against the Raiders and the NFL. During the Raiders game against the Miami Dolphins on Monday Night Football, ABC aired an interview that Allen had done just before the game with Al Michaels. Allen unloaded on Davis accusing the Raiders’ owner of trying to ruin his career. Allen’s interview was so incendiary that Michaels told Allen to call if he wanted to retract any of his statements. Allen would not back down and the interview was aired. The reaction was immediate. Though Davis made no public statement, Coach Shell went on the air, accusing Allen of lying. Despite all the division he had caused within the organization, Allen’s teammates voted to give him the Commitment to Excellence Award as the team’s most inspirational player. After 11 years with the team, his time with the Raiders was over. Allen told “Sport” magazine’s Dan Dieffenbach that he was not bitter about his time with Los Angeles: “To me, it is all an education. It was a wonderful education. Although I hated it, I didn’t realize it at the time. When I was going through it, there was not light at the end of the tunnel for me, but when you look back at it and deal with everything, it was a tremendous experience.”
